From: Vsevolod Stakhov Date: Tue, 22 Jan 2019 12:18:23 +0000 (+0000) Subject: [Minor] Lua_udp: Fix event deletion X-Git-Tag: 1.9.0~275 X-Git-Url: https://source.dussan.org/?a=commitdiff_plain;h=17a9df2207add70ba14d2ab8afceed18f9e33fa1;p=rspamd.git [Minor] Lua_udp: Fix event deletion --- diff --git a/src/lua/lua_udp.c b/src/lua/lua_udp.c index d5e743048..aac22695f 100644 --- a/src/lua/lua_udp.c +++ b/src/lua/lua_udp.c @@ -115,7 +115,7 @@ lua_udp_cbd_fin (gpointer p) struct lua_udp_cbdata *cbd = (struct lua_udp_cbdata *)p; if (cbd->sock != -1) { - if (rspamd_event_pending (&cbd->io, EV_READ|EV_WRITE)) { + if (cbd->io.ev_base != NULL) { event_del (&cbd->io); }